摘要
针对铜的原材料价格上涨,“铝代铜”成为制冷行业的发展趋势这一现状,研究了采用铜铝管制造的冷凝器、蒸发器及空调连接配管等.为提高铜铝管控制精度和焊接范围,在原有基础上采用了PLC与文本显示器相结合的方法进行控制,使焊接时间的控制精度由0.01S提高到0.001S;采用容量为50kVA的焊接线圈,扩大了焊机焊接范围,使其能焊接外径为6~20mm、壁厚为0.5~1.25mm的铜铝管.多年应用结果表明,铜铝管焊接质量稳定、优良.
Due to the increase in material price of copper, there has been a trend for employing aluminum pipe instead of cooper pipe in refrigeration industry. Cu-Al pipe can be used to produce the condensers, evaporators and connect pipe for air-condition. In order to enhance the control precision of the welding period and extend the application range for the Cu-Al pipe welding machine, the PLC and TP04G text display control was adopted. Thus the control precision of welding period gets up to 0. 001 s from 0. 01 s. The application range of the Cu-Al pipe welding machine is extended by using the welding coil with a capacity of 50 kVA, where the copper and aluminum pipes with outside diameter of 6 to 20 mm and wall thickness of 0. 5 to 1.25 mm can be welded. The practical application shows that the welding quality of Cu- Al pipe is steady and excellent.
